Eau Claire Main Post Office – Passport Acceptance Facility

EAU CLAIRE MAIN POST OFFICE – Quick Facts

  • The Eau Claire Main Post Office is located at 225 East Madison Street, Eau Claire, WI 54703.
  • Operating hours for passport services are typically Monday through Friday, 8:30 AM to 4:00 PM, but it’s best to call ahead to confirm due to staffing variations.
  • Metered street parking is available but can be limited; a nearby parking ramp at 404 Eau Claire Street offers a more reliable parking option.
  • Appointments are highly recommended to minimize wait times, though walk-ins are accepted based on availability.
  • Passport photos can be taken on-site for a fee of $15.00 at a self-service kiosk.
  • This facility accepts applications for new passports (Form DS-11) and renewals if eligible (Form DS-82).
  • Be sure to bring all required documentation, including proof of citizenship, a valid photo ID, and the appropriate application forms.
  • Payment for the passport application fee must be made by check or money order payable to ‘U.S. Department of State’.

Location & How to Get Here

🚗 From Downtown

Located at EAU CLAIRE MAIN POST OFFICE at 225 EAST MADISON ST. Easy access from major highways.

🅿️ Parking Info

Parking near the Eau Claire Main Post Office can be a bit challenging, especially during peak hours. Metered street parking is available on East Madison Street and Barstow Street, costing $1.25 per hour with a two-hour time limit, enforced Monday through Friday from 8:00 AM to 6:00 PM. Alternatively, the Central Parking Ramp located at 404 Eau Claire Street, approximately 0.2 miles (or 2 blocks) north of the post office, offers covered parking at a rate of $10 per day. A smaller, 25-space free parking lot is available behind the post office, accessible via Wisconsin Street, but it fills up quickly. During winter months, be mindful of potential ice and snow accumulation on sidewalks and in parking lots. To ensure a stress-free appointment, arrive 15-20 minutes early to allow ample time to find parking. Consider using the parking ramp during peak hours or on weekdays to avoid the hassle of street parking.

🚌 Public Transit

The Eau Claire Main Post Office is conveniently accessible via the Eau Claire Transit system. Bus Route #3, which runs along Barstow Street, stops directly in front of the post office at the corner of Barstow and Madison. Bus Route #6 also has a stop only one block away at Wisconsin and Grand Ave. Buses operate every 30 minutes on weekdays and every 60 minutes on Saturdays. A single ride fare is $2.00, and a day pass costs $4.50. The Eau Claire Transit Transfer Center is located approximately 0.7 miles southwest of the post office, offering connections to all other bus routes in the city. The post office entrance is wheelchair accessible, and all Eau Claire Transit buses are equipped with wheelchair lifts. From the Transit Transfer Center, exit onto Farwell Street, walk north for three blocks, turn right onto Madison Street, and continue for four blocks to reach the post office.

What to Expect at EAU CLAIRE MAIN POST OFFICE

Walking into Eau Claire Main Post Office, you’ll immediately notice the building’s classic mid-century architecture, characterized by clean lines and large windows allowing ample natural light. The main entrance is located on the south side of the building, directly facing East Madison Street. Upon entering, proceed to the designated passport application window, usually Window #3, clearly marked with signage. Although appointments are preferred, if you are a walk-in, sign in on the clipboard located on the counter near the window. The waiting area is relatively small, with approximately 8-10 chairs available. Expect a wait time of 15-40 minutes depending on the day and time. Once called, the agent will guide you through the application process, reviewing your documents and taking payment. The entire appointment, including document review and payment processing, typically lasts between 18 and 22 minutes. The facility is ADA accessible, with ramps at the entrance and accessible restrooms available.

To apply for a passport at the Eau Claire Main Post Office, you’ll need several key documents. First, bring proof of U.S. citizenship, such as an original or certified copy of your birth certificate. Also, you’ll need a valid photo ID, like a driver’s license or state-issued ID. If you’re renewing a passport, bring your expired passport. Finally, bring a passport photo that meets the official requirements, or you can have your photo taken on site for an additional fee of $15.00.
